We're building a mobile-browser multiplayer arena game set in a colorful, stylized urban neighborhood. Players ride open-top Kekes (auto-rickshaws) with visible drivers, dodge city chaos, and score "StrikeOuts" against rivals to become the Last Survivor. Hole.io / Squad Busters / Zooba polish and readability, fun, local, arcade. Not realistic, not military, no blood. The game is already built and playable, server-authoritative multiplayer, real controls, hazards, collisions, full HUD, running entirely on placeholder art. We need an artist to give it its real look. Because the game already runs, your art goes into the live game as you deliver it, and you get to see it in a real match within minutes. Fast, concrete feedback. Engine: PlayCanvas (real 3D, WebGL). Fixed bird's-eye camera at a steep 3/4, near-isometric angle locked, does not rotate. --- WHAT WE NEED --- Kekes (the player vehicle, highest priority) - Open-top rickshaw with a visible driver, readable from above - Male and female rider variants - Front-mounted stylized "tag blaster" (playful energy weapon, not a firearm) - Rigged, with a looping drive animation. Later: fire, hit, spin-out states Environment: modular, not one monolithic scene - Stylized Abuja-inspired neighborhood: wide roads, junctions, low-rise buildings with real height, compound walls and gates, fuel station, kiosks and roadside shops, parked cars, billboards, signage, trees/green patches - City-chaos hazards: police checkpoint, potholes, roadblock cones, moving Okada/Keke traffic - Baked lighting: soft, slightly-cinematic sunlight and shadows baked into lightmaps. The camera is fixed, so this is cheap and looks great Props and FX - 4 power-up pickups: speed, shield, magnet, shot boost - Tag-shot projectile mesh (tinted to the firing player's color at runtime) - Particle FX (trails, impacts, bump/spin-out, reward celebration) are currently engine particles texture sheets for these are welcome but lower priority than the models above More details, including GDD, asset list, etc will be provided. Not needed: HUD, UI, icons or menus. Those are built in code. --- STYLE --- Polished, mid-fidelity stylized 3D, smooth rounded forms, richly textured, soft baked lighting, real 2.5D depth. Modern casual-mobile fidelity. Important: NOT flat-shaded low-poly (not Crossy Road / Hole.io), and NOT photoreal. Somewhere between - Clash of Clans / Zooba / Rush Royale is the fidelity bar. Readability rule: on a small phone screen a player must instantly tell who is a player, what is cover, and where they can drive. If it's not instantly clear, it's too detailed. Local and recognizably urban neighborhood, but inspired-by, not a street-by-street clone of a real neighborhood. We'll share our north-star mockup, full art brief and a dimensioned map layout with shortlisted candidates. --- TECHNICAL REQUIREMENTS (please confirm you can meet these) --- 1. Delivery format: glTF / GLB. Draco mesh compression welcome. 2. Runtime color tinting - the most important one. Every player drives the same Keke mesh, recolored per player in code, for 20+ distinct colors. So the Keke needs exactly two materials: "Body" - the recolorable surface, delivered in a neutral/light tone with the color NOT baked into the texture "Details" - wheels, driver, blaster, glass; keeps its own colors The same applies to the projectile mesh (tinted to the shooter's color). 3. Poly budget: 4,000 tris max for Keke + rider combined (LOD0), plus LOD1 around 1,500 and LOD2 around 600. We can have 20-40 Kekes on screen at once on mid-range Android phones, so this is a firm limit. Props and environment budgets will be specified per asset. 4. Textures: shared atlases, 1024x1024 or smaller, KTX2/Basis compression (we can handle the KTX2 conversion). Consistent light direction across all assets. 5. Modular environment built to supplied dimensions. Collision in our game is authoritative in server code fixed rectangles for every wall, building and prop. We'll give you a dimensioned blockout of the map, and environment pieces need to match those volumes so the art doesn't visually contradict where cover actually is. Repeated props must be instanceable. 6. Conventions: nose pointing +Z, origin at ground level and centered, wheels sitting at Y=0. Clean node hierarchy. No scene lights, cameras or helper objects in the exported GLB. 7. Rider as a separate mesh/node from the vehicle, so male and female variants can be swapped without rebuilding the Keke. 8. Total size discipline: the same art has to fit inside a 5 MB single-file build for an offline playable version, alongside the main game.
